Burnet Storms Home in Vets Golf

Tony Burnet, Ken Kelly.

IT WAS Tony Burnet’s day on Tuesday, 2 December, when the Gloucester Veteran Golfers turned out for their normal weekly outing; he finished three points ahead of the field and played seven under handicap.

The event was played in cloudy and moderately warm conditions on a course starting to suffer from the lack of any substantial rain over the past several weeks.

The event was an Individual Stableford sponsored by Ken Kelly and the winner was Tony Burnet with a big 43 points. Carolyn Davies finished with 40 points in the runners up spot. Balls were won by Ele Fraser 39, Derek Bardwell and Trevor Sharp 36, Hugh Toprode, Chris Steele and Ken Kelly 35 with Dale Rabbett, 34, picking up the last trophy ball on a count back.

The Nearest-to-the-Pin trophy at the 4th and 13th holes was won by Derek Wand; at the 6th and 15th holes that honour went to Elaine Murray and Trevor Sharp.

This immediate past Tuesday, 9 December, the Gloucester Veterans played an Individual Stableford sponsored by Debbie and Peter Sate. Tuesday of next week they play a Four Ball Aggregate Stableford.
